Explanation:

When launching a new apparel brand in a dry and hot desert town like those found in Rajasthan, the primary consideration should be the geological and environmental factors that influence the characteristics of the apparel. The extreme weather conditions in such regions necessitate a focus on materials and designs that can withstand and protect against the harsh climate.

Geological factors, such as the dry and hot climate, are the most relevant when deciding on the characteristics of apparel. The materials used must be breathable and lightweight to allow for air circulation and reduce heat retention. Fabrics like cotton, linen, and other natural fibers are ideal as they are breathable and can help keep the body cool. Additionally, the design of the apparel should be loose-fitting to allow for better air circulation and to prevent the body from overheating.

While psychological factors, such as consumer preferences and attitudes, and demographic factors, such as age, gender, and income levels, are important for understanding the target market, they are secondary to the environmental conditions. The primary concern is to create apparel that is functional and comfortable in the harsh desert climate.

Behavioral factors, such as how consumers use and interact with the apparel, are also important but should be considered after ensuring that the apparel is suitable for the environmental conditions. For example, the design should be practical for daily activities and should not hinder movement or comfort.

In summary, when launching a new apparel brand in a dry and hot desert town, the geological factors are the most critical in determining the characteristics of the apparel. The focus should be on creating apparel that is functional, comfortable, and suitable for the extreme weather conditions, with materials and designs that can withstand the harsh climate.
